Spotting the Early Warning Signs of A/C Trouble

When property owners observe unexpected shifts in their air conditioning units, it often signals the need for repair. Common early warning signs include inconsistent cooling, where some areas of the home feel hotter than the rest, or the system has difficulty holding the desired temperature. Odd noises, including grinding or hissing, can point to mechanical problems or refrigerant leaks. Furthermore, an unanticipated spike in utility bills may indicate that the unit is straining to cool the space, often due to inefficiencies. Homeowners should also be alert to unusual odors, particularly musty or burning smells, which could indicate electrical issues or mold development. Finally, if the AC unit constantly switches on and off, this may suggest a defective thermostat or other underlying concerns. Spotting these indicators early on can help avoid significant damage and high repair costs.

How to Fix Your A/C When It's Blowing Warm Air

When an air conditioning unit blows warm air, a few key checks can often resolve the issue. Initially, confirming the thermostat settings validates that the system is properly set to cooling mode. Additionally, checking the air filters and reviewing the refrigerant levels can assist in pinpointing frequent issues that may prevent optimal performance.

Review Thermostat Settings

How can one guarantee their air conditioner is running optimally? An important initial step is checking the thermostat settings. Frequently, the cause of warm air can be attributed to improper settings. Ensuring the thermostat is set to the desired cooling temperature is fundamental. When dealing with a programmable thermostat, examining its schedule for conflicts or overrides may prove useful. It is also vital to check that the thermostat is properly set to "cool" mode, since it could mistakenly be set to "heat" or "off". If the settings appear correct but the problem persists, recalibrating the thermostat or replacing its batteries might be necessary. Addressing these simple checks can often restore the desired comfort level in the home.

Inspect Air Filters

Examining air filters is essential for preserving peak air conditioning operation. Obstructed or soiled filters can limit airflow, causing the system to operate less efficiently and potentially leading to excessive heat buildup. This poor performance often results in warm air blowing through vents, indicating a need for prompt action. Homeowners should check filters monthly, especially during peak usage periods. If filters look dirty or stained, replacing them is a quick remedy that can return the system to full efficiency. Typically, filters should be changed every thirty to ninety days, depending on usage and environmental factors. Regular care of air filters not only enhances cooling efficiency but also promotes cleaner indoor air, creating a better indoor living space. Timely inspections can avoid larger problems in the future.

Inspect Refrigerant Amounts

A depleted refrigerant level can significantly affect an air conditioner's capacity to cool properly. When the refrigerant is insufficient, the system fails to absorb heat efficiently, resulting in warm air blowing from the vents. Homeowners should regularly check refrigerant levels as part of their ongoing maintenance plan. If a reduction in cooling capacity is detected, this could signal a refrigerant leak or depletion. To resolve this problem, a qualified technician should be contacted to assess the system. They can identify leaks and recharge the refrigerant to the manufacturer's specifications. Neglecting refrigerant issues can lead to more significant problems, including compressor damage. Prompt inspection of refrigerant levels ensures optimal performance and prolongs the lifespan of the air conditioning unit.

What Different Sounds From Your Air Conditioning Unit Indicate

When an HVAC unit generates odd noises, it often signals underlying issues that require attention. Buzzing sounds may indicate electrical problems, whereas hissing sounds may signal refrigerant leaks. Moreover, clanging noises often point to loose or deteriorated components within the system.

Buzzing Sounds Point to Issues

Buzzing noises coming from an air conditioning unit frequently indicate deeper problems that demand prompt attention. Such sounds can signal numerous potential issues, including electrical issues, loose components, or malfunctioning motors. When the unit has difficulty functioning properly, it may emit a constant buzzing sound, implying that the electrical connections may be damaged or that foreign material is blocking the fan. Moreover, this noise can point to a defective capacitor, which is critical to the compressor's performance. Ignoring these noises can lead to greater damage and higher repair costs. Homeowners should not dismiss these warning signs and should contact a qualified technician to evaluate and fix the issue without delay, safeguarding the ongoing performance and lifespan of their AC system.

Warning Signs of a Hissing Noise

Numerous homeowners may notice hissing noises emanating from their AC units, which can suggest certain problems that need attention. A hissing often suggests a leak in the refrigerant, where the refrigerant escapes through small gaps or cracks in the system. This not only compromises overall cooling efficiency but can also negatively impact the environment. Furthermore, hissing can result from a obstructed or faulty expansion valve, which regulates refrigerant circulation. If the sound is accompanied by fluctuating temperatures or decreased cooling performance, it signals further complications. Homeowners should address these sounds promptly, as ignoring them can lead to costlier repairs or system failure. Identifying these warning signs is critical for maintaining an efficient and effective air conditioning system.

Rattling Noises from Loose Components

Clanging noises from an air conditioning unit frequently indicate worn or faulty components that require immediate attention. These disturbances may arise from multiple locations inside the system. As an illustration, loose screws or bolts can cause internal components to rattle, while a damaged fan may impact the outer casing, generating a striking noise. Additionally, issues with the compressor or the ductwork can also contribute to these disruptive noises. Disregarding these noises may result in more serious issues, including diminished performance or total unit breakdown. Homeowners should consider calling a qualified technician to diagnose and address any underlying issues promptly. Prompt attention can eliminate unnecessary expenses and confirm the air conditioning unit performs consistently and effectively.

How Strange Odors Indicate A/C Repair Needs

In what ways can unusual smells indicate the need for air conditioning repair? Offensive smells coming from an A/C system commonly point to underlying concerns that need immediate addressing. A damp, musty smell could indicate mold or mildew development inside the unit, which may compromise indoor air quality. A smoky odor might signal overheating components or electrical issues, which could pose a fire hazard. On the other hand, a chemical or sweet scent could signify a refrigerant leak, demanding timely service to prevent further damage and maintain efficient operation.

Understanding these smells and grasping their implications is essential for property owners. Neglecting such signs can result in expensive repairs and decreased system performance. Therefore, tackling unusual smells promptly can protect both the air conditioning system and the safety of its inhabitants.

Are Your Energy Bills Higher Because of Your A/C?

Have energy bills been climbing unexpectedly in spite of routine A/C operation? This situation may indicate underlying issues with the air conditioning unit. A poorly maintained or aging system may have difficulty cooling a home effectively, resulting in higher energy usage. Factors such as clogged filters, refrigerant leaks, or malfunctioning thermostats can greatly impact performance, making the system exert more effort than required.

In addition, poor insulation or air leaks throughout the home can worsen this issue, causing cooled air to seep out and compelling the A/C to operate for extended periods. Homeowners ought to keep a close eye on their energy bills to detect patterns that indicate possible inefficiencies. If costs continue to rise without a clear explanation, it may be time to contemplate an inspection or repair of the air conditioning system. Addressing these issues promptly can help restore efficiency and potentially reduce those soaring energy bills.

The Importance of Regular A/C Maintenance

Why is regular A/C maintenance essential for peak performance? Regular maintenance ensures that air conditioning systems run efficiently and reliably. By consistently inspecting and maintaining units, homeowners can avoid potential failures and prolong the life of their systems. This service commonly encompasses cleaning or changing filters, monitoring refrigerant levels, and reviewing electrical connections.

Additionally, regular maintenance allows minor issues to be identified before they develop into expensive repairs. A regularly serviced A/C unit functions more effectively, leading to lower energy bills and a more comfortable living environment. Additionally, regular check-ups can improve indoor air quality by preventing dust and allergens from circulating throughout the home. Ultimately, putting time and resources into A/C care not only strengthens performance but also fosters a healthier, more energy-saving home environment. Routine servicing represents a proactive method of making certain that air conditioning systems perform optimally during peak demand.

Questions We Often Receive

How Regularly Should I Schedule Air Conditioning Maintenance?

Specialists suggest planning air conditioner service no less than one time per year, preferably prior to the start of the cooling season. Regular check-ups secure top-level efficiency, prolong the system's service life, and reduce the risk of untimely malfunctions during heavy use.

Can I Fix My A/C on My Own?

He may try small fixes if knowledgeable, but complex issues frequently demand professional expertise. Security risks and possible warranty invalidation make consulting an expert advisable for serious technical issues to provide safe and effective functioning.

What Do I Gain by Upgrading My A/C System?

Updating an air conditioning system enhances operational efficiency, decreases electricity costs, improves the air quality indoors, adds to home value, and offers enhanced cooling performance. Such improvements result in a more pleasant and healthier indoor environment.

What Is the Expected Lifespan of My Air Conditioning Unit?

An air conditioner usually operates for anywhere from 15 to 20 years, depending on the frequency of use, upkeep, and the quality of the unit. Consistent professional servicing can extend its lifespan, while neglect can result in unexpected breakdowns and a decline in efficiency.

What Is the Ideal Temperature Setting for My A/C to Maximize Efficiency?

For best results, configuring the air conditioner between 72°F and 78°F is suggested. This temperature range strikes a balance between comfort and energy use, permitting the system to run at peak performance while lowering power consumption costs throughout the cooling season.
